Career Path

Event Coordinator: Plan and execute events, ensuring seamless operations and client satisfaction. High demand in the UK job market.

Volunteer Manager: Oversee volunteer programs, recruitment, and training to support organizational goals. Growing demand in non-profits.

Fundraising Manager: Develop strategies to secure funding and manage donor relationships. Critical for charity and event sectors.

Conference Planner: Organize professional conferences, managing logistics and attendee experiences. Key role in corporate and academic sectors.

Community Engagement Officer: Foster relationships with local communities to drive participation and support. Essential for public and non-profit organizations.
